NAIA names 34 as Women's Golf Scholar-Athletes

NAIA names 34 as Women's Golf Scholar-Athletes

KANSAS CITY, Mo. - (NAIA Release) - The Wolverine-Hoosier Athletic Conference (WHAC) saw 34 named Daktronics-NAIA Scholar-Athletes for the sport of women's golf. Nominees are submitted by an institution’s head coach or sports information director and must maintain a minimum grade point average of 3.5 on a 4.0 scale, appear on the eligibility certificate for the sport, and have attended one full year at said institution.

Cleary led the way for the conference with six honorees while Lawrence Tech, Lourdes, and UNOH each had four named. Indiana Tech and Siena Heights placed three apiece on the team while Aquinas, Concordia, Cornerstone, and Madonn all had two.
